Focusing on the lives of girls in the juvenile justice system, this ethnographic study highlights their navigation through complex race, class, and gender hierarchies. Through rich narratives, the girls' struggles for social status in various environments—families, institutions, and neighborhoods—are explored. The book encourages a rethinking of policies and programs to better support these girls' aspirations. It provides deep insights into their experiences, making it a valuable resource for scholars in criminal justice, sociology, women's studies, and social psychology.
